Brian Haines (19**-). British actor.
Contents
Contribution to SA theatre, film, media and/or performance
He came to South Africa to star in Monté Doyle’s Time to Kill which was the first production at the Johannesburg Reps for 1961. It also starred Heather Lloyd-Jones.
